Definition
"Das hydraulische System" refers to a technology that uses liquid fluid power to perform work, usually by controlling and transmitting energy through pressurized fluids. It enables precise movement and operation of machinery, as in the example phrase where it controls machine movement accurately.
Etymology
The term "das hydraulische System" comes from the Greek word 'hydraulikos,' meaning 'water pipe' or 'water organ.' 'Hydraulics' originally referred to the science of water movement but now broadly describes fluid power systems. 'System' is derived from the Greek 'systēma,' meaning 'organized whole.' Together, they describe an organized setup using fluid power for technical purposes.
